Output 85dc112531f58af53799eeb810c32e3d5f3024c2720fa78ba2690a2326db25b5:1

value
29669538
script pubkey
OP_0 OP_PUSHBYTES_20 40389523ae3cec4918ee9888fda3f30b4af9b8cd
address
ltc1qgquf2gaw8nkyjx8wnzy0mglnpd90nwxd8wrrae
transaction
85dc112531f58af53799eeb810c32e3d5f3024c2720fa78ba2690a2326db25b5
spent
true